The King James Version of the Bible first coined the term Apocrypha and set these sets of books apart from the rest. The roman catholic bibles still contain these books in the old testament, but they are not called apocryphal, instead they are called deuterocanonical. this means that they belong to the second canon, which refers to a list of literary works accepted as the word of god.

Although many different versions of the Bible have been developed over the centuries, the Roman Catholic tradition has always been to remain as faithful as possible to the original word of God. that is why they prefer to keep the additional books as part of their sacred text.

what are the 14 books removed from the bible?

in 1684 it was decided to remove the following 14 books from some versions of the bible:

  • 1 esdras
  • 2 esdras
  • tobit
  • judith
  • the rest of esther
  • the wisdom of solomon
  • ecclesiastic (also known as sirac)
  • baruch with the epistle of jeremiah
  • the songs of the 3 holy children
  • the story of susana
  • bel and the dragon
  • the prayer of manasseh
  • 1 Maccabees
  • 2 Maccabees

while the catholic faith continued to keep the books in a separate section of their bible, when looking at different versions of the bible today, you will find that some contain all of these books, while others contain a select few.

tobit

the book of tobit is about tobit and his family living outside of israel as exiles. Tobit eventually goes blind and is forced to send his son, Tobias, on a journey with the angel Raphael disguised as a human. This is when Tobias meets Sarah, who is possessed by a demon, but Raphael is able to intervene and expel the demon, allowing Tobias and Sarah to marry.

judith

judith’s story centers on a young woman who is upset with everyone around her for not trusting god to give them what they need.

She goes with her maid to a nearby camp with an enemy general named Holofernes who is preparing to fight the very men she is trying to help. Holofernes manages to coerce her into providing information on the whereabouts of the Israelites.

She ends up gaining his trust and he allows her access to his store one night when he’s drunk. judith cuts off holofernes’s head and takes it to the countrymen who feared him.

all the people who were led by him scatter. The outcome of the story is a victory for the Israelites but Judith remains single for the rest of her life.

baruch with the epistle of jeremiah

Baruch is Jeremiah’s scribe and is considered the author of this entire book. The book is a reflection of the circumstances involving the exiled Jews in Babylon. In fact, the book is written directly for the citizens of Jerusalem with guidelines that they must follow. the book focuses on wisdom and is believed by many to have been written during the Maccabean period.

however this is one of the most accepted pieces of the removed books and is still present in the greek orthodox bible and the vulgate bible which also contains the letter of jeremiah.

bel and the dragon

here we have another book that was from the book of daniel. this is chapter 13 and in fact it didn’t even make it into any version of the bible. this story was rejected by the church from the beginning.

is a single story of daniel in the court of cyrus. Bel’s story denounces idol worship, and the king tests Daniel by asking him if he believes Bel is a living god. The king is furious when Daniel denies Bel and is not impressed by what the king says.

The king demands that 70 priests show Daniel’s offerings to be made to the idol. bel then he must consume all the offerings and if he does not, the priests will be sentenced to death. If he does, Daniel will be put to death.

Daniel spreads ashes all over the temple floor only to discover that the food was actually eaten by the priests, wives and children who enter through a secret door when the temple doors are closed.

The next morning, the king comes to see that the food has been consumed, but Daniel draws his attention to the footprints of different sizes that indicate that a large group of people was present. the priests are arrested, the secret passage is found, and everyone involved receives a death sentence.

where can you find an original bible?

Note that there is no such thing as an “original” bible. The Bible consists of a large number of books and stories that were compiled over time. as a result, there can be no single original bible.

the books of the bible were written by many different people at different times. Many different interpretations have resulted over the centuries, creating a wide range of translations and inclusions or exclusions of books, such as the Apocrypha.
